    Moderation means to do things just right, or to exhort others not to go too far and be aggressive.

    Shikezhi (pinyin: shì kěér zhǐ) is an idiom that first appeared in Confucius's Analects of the Township Party.

    Stopping in moderation means stopping at an appropriate level, not overdoing it; It is often used as a metaphor to do things just right. Complimentary; It is generally used as a predicate and object in a sentence.

    Example sentences that are enough to stop:1. Alcohol can be drunk, but only in moderation to avoid damage to health.

    2. Jokes that can be stopped in moderation can increase the interest of life.

    3. Don't eat too much at each meal, it's best to stop in moderation.

    4. Exercise in moderation is good for promoting health.

    5. We must do everything in moderation and not excessively.

    6. However, due to the high cholesterol of dried scallops, the amount should be moderate.

    Enough means to stop when it's right. The metaphor is just right.

    Idiom meaning

    Explanation: Stop when it's right. The metaphor is just right.

    Source: Pre-Qin Confucius's "Analects of the Township Party": "Don't eat much", Song Zhuxi's collection notes: "Enough is enough, no greed." ”

    Grammar: Moderate rather than formal; as a predicate, object; Complimentary;

    Example: No storm ever lasts. Sure enough, it lasts, and we can't bear it, so we want it to be in moderation. Wen Yiduo "The Self-Redemption of Palace Poems".

    synonyms: just right, just right.

    Antonyms: too much, too much, insatiable.
